The shoulder is my left, and i'm sure its a rotator cuff. i'm going to stay off it for a week... as well as my whole upper body.

should i rest completely or can i still do legs?

If it's been a while since you took a break I would probably just take the week off, if not you could probably still manage leg press, extensions etc, but I would definitely stay away from squats as that still puts strain on the shoulders.